do you need a license for standing-seam roof work in alaska?
No statewide roofing license exists. Alaska dropped its general contractor licensing years back and never issued a roofing-specific trade license. The state runs a business registry through the Department of Commerce, Community, and Economic Development (DCCED). If you're hanging a shingle, you register a business entity and get a DCCED business license. That's the paper trail at the state level [1].
What you will need locally: a business license or privilege license from the municipality or borough where the job sits. Anchorage, Fairbanks North Star Borough, Juneau, and Mat-Su Borough each run their own registration, and some add an endorsement for construction trades. These are not competency tests. They are revenue ordinances. You also need a valid contractor's bond in any jurisdiction that requires one. Anchorage, for example, requires a $10,000 contractor license bond as of 2025 [5].
There is one exception worth flagging. If your standing-seam work touches a federal property, a military base, or a Native corporation building that triggers federal prevailing wage, you may need to show no record of debarment and carry specific insurance endorsements. Nobody in state government pre-checks this for you. Ask the project owner or general contractor for their vendor qualification packet before you bid.
Insurance is not optional anywhere in Alaska. Most municipalities and every sharp homeowner will demand proof of general liability (commonly $1 million per occurrence) and workers' compensation. Alaska requires workers' comp for any employee, including yourself if your business is not a registered exemption. The Alaska Workers' Compensation Board confirms a sole proprietor can file for a waiver, but if you hire even a day-labor helper, you need coverage before the first hour of work [6].
how much does a standing-seam roof renewal cost in alaska?
Installed cost runs $18 to $35 per square foot for a full standing-seam overlay or a tear-off and replacement in Alaska as of mid-2025. That range is wide because three variables swing the number harder here than anywhere in the Lower 48: freight, snow-load engineering, and access.
Here's how the cost breaks down on a typical 2,000 sq ft single-family roof in Southcentral Alaska:
- Panel material (24-gauge Kynar-coated steel): $6.00, $10.00/sq ft delivered, depending on whether the order rides a Seattle barge or air freight to a smaller community.
- Underlayment and ice-and-water shield: $2.00, $4.00/sq ft. Alaska's cold pushes most specs to full-coverage peel-and-stick membrane, more than eave strips.
- Labor (3 to 4 person crew, 4 to 8 weeks on site): $7.00, $14.00/sq ft. Steep pitches above 6:12, dormer-heavy cuts, and hand-seaming in remote areas push labor toward the top.
- Engineering and permit package: $800, $2,500 flat. Any roof in a snow-load zone (which is basically all of Alaska) needs stamped drawings showing the system meets the ground snow load for the site. The code assigns 50 to 300 psf ground snow loads across Alaska. Palmer sits at 50 psf. Valdez at 160 psf. Juneau's design load can hit 80 psf or more with elevation [7]. That stamp adds real dollars and weeks.
- Old-roof disposal: $1.50, $3.00/sq ft plus dump fees if the tear-off goes to a landfill.
A "renewal," often called a roof-over or overlay, installs new standing-seam panels on top of the existing roofing and skips the tear-off cost. It only works if the existing deck and fastening pattern are sound and the code official accepts one layer. In humid coastal Alaska, trapped moisture under a second roof layer is a real decay risk. Many engineers in Southeast Alaska will not stamp a roof-over without a ventilated air gap detail. Pull off an overlay and you might cut $4,000 to $7,000 off a typical house job. If you can't, you tear off.
Spot-check numbers from actual Alaska quotes in 2024 to 2025 tell the story. A 1,950 sq ft standing-seam renewal in Wasilla came in at $48,750 ($25/sq ft), including tear-off, peel-and-stick membrane, and 24-gauge snap-lock panels [8]. A smaller 1,300 sq ft roof in Juneau with mechanical-seam panels and a full structural retrofit for snow load hit $58,500 ($45/sq ft), because the engineer required extra truss reinforcement [2]. Shipping alone added $3,200 in barge freight from Seattle for that Juneau job.
Alaska has no state sales tax, though some boroughs and cities levy their own. So your material cost won't take a giant tax markup at the point of sale. The big number is freight.
how long does a standing-seam roof renewal take in alaska?
Plan on 4 to 10 weeks from signed contract to final inspection for a house-sized standing-seam renewal in Alaska. Nobody knocks one out in two weeks here.
Real timeline for a typical 2,000 sq ft residential job inside the road system (Anchorage, Mat-Su, Kenai Peninsula):
- Engineering and permit: 1 to 3 weeks. The structural engineer produces stamped drawings and calcs showing the system handles the site's ground snow load. The local building department has 15 to 30 business days for plan review in most cities [9]. Anchorage currently averages 18 business days for residential reroof permits [10].
- Material procurement: 2 to 5 weeks. If the metal is in stock at a Seattle or Portland distributor, a week to stage plus a week on the barge gets it to Anchorage. Add another week to truck it to Fairbanks or Kenai. Mill orders (custom lengths, specific colors) add 3 to 4 weeks before freight even begins. Off-road-system jobs in Nome, Kotzebue, or Dillingham wait for seasonal barge windows. A mid-winter job in Bethel might wait six weeks for the next river barge. Air freight is fast but eats your margin.
- On-site work: 1 to 3 weeks for a straightforward tear-off and re-roof with a four-person crew, weather permitting. Add a week for steep pitches, complex valleys, or snow-bracket systems.
- Inspection: 2 to 5 business days after the contractor calls it in.
Weather is not a side note in Alaska. It runs the schedule. A reroof started in late September in Anchorage can lose 60% of its working days to rain, ice, or wind shutdowns [4]. The crew that bangs out a roof in 10 days in August might need 18 in October. The National Weather Service Anchorage office reports September and October average 14 to 18 days with measurable precipitation, and November piles on high-wind events that ground crane and panel-handling work [11]. Most Alaska roofers book standing-seam work for May through mid-September and treat October as a hard shoulder season.
The permit clock matters too. If your application sits in the queue for three weeks and the engineer takes two, you've burned five weeks before a single panel lands. Contractors who eat schedule risk on Alaska reroofs typically carry a 15% contingency in the timeline they promise the owner. If someone tells you two weeks, ask to see the permit already in hand.
can you do a standing-seam roof renewal over an existing roof in alaska?
Yes, in many cases, but Alaska's code and climate push harder against roof-overs than warm, dry states do. The 2018 International Residential Code (IRC), adopted as the state building code, allows a second roof layer as long as the existing roof is not water-soaked and the structure can carry the added dead load [12]. The problem in Alaska is the dead-load math.
A standing-seam system adds 1.0 to 2.5 pounds per square foot of panel and underlayment weight on top of whatever the existing roof already weighs. In a 50 psf ground-snow-load zone like Wasilla, the trusses were likely designed for 40 psf live load (snow) plus 10 psf dead load. Tack on another layer of shingles plus metal plus underlayment, and you eat into the dead-load allowance. In a 160 psf zone like Valdez, the trusses already carry enormous design loads, and the engineer may reject any added weight if the structure shows sag or corrosion.
Most Alaska building departments want a structural engineer's letter for a roof-over, not a contractor's say-so. The letter states the existing assembly's weight, the added weight of the new system, and the remaining capacity for snow. Without that stamp, the permit office sends you back.
Moisture entrapment is the second deal-killer. Overlay metal on shingles in Ketchikan, where annual rainfall tops 140 inches, and you build a vapor sandwich that rots the deck from the top side. IRC section R908.4 requires "adequate ventilation" for roof-overs, which in cold-climate practice often means a 1.5-inch ventilated air gap between the old roof and the new underlayment. Building a ventilated nail base grid over shingles adds $2.00 to $4.00 per square foot, but it's the only detail many Southeast Alaska code officials will approve [13].
So: roof-overs are possible and sometimes the right call on a dry, sound structure in Interior Alaska. In coastal zones or anywhere with a high snow load, expect the engineer to ask you to strip to the deck.
what snow-load standards govern standing-seam roofs in alaska?
Alaska uses the IRC and IBC for structural design, but the snow-load map in the code is the real authority. The Alaska Snow Load Report, published by the Structural Engineers Association of Alaska (SEAA) and adopted by reference in many boroughs, assigns ground snow loads by community and elevation [7].
A few reference numbers from the SEAA map: Anchorage, 50 psf. Fairbanks, 60 psf. Juneau, 55 psf at sea level but 80 psf or more above 500 feet. Valdez, 160 psf, one of the highest in the state. Thompson Pass near Valdez regularly sees over 600 inches of annual snowfall, and the design load reflects that.
The engineering package for your renewal must match the panel system's allowable span and clip capacity to the site-specific roof snow load, not a generic catalog number. Panel manufacturers publish load tables for their clip-and-seam systems. A typical 24-gauge mechanical-seam panel with 24-inch clip spacing handles 40 to 60 psf snow load at a 4-foot span, but that drops fast as the span lengthens or the gauge lightens [3]. An engineer may require closer clip spacing or heavier-gauge panels for roofs above 6:12 in high-load zones because of sliding snow forces.
Snow brackets and snow fences are part of the renewal conversation in Alaska, not an afterthought. Codes and plain common sense require snow-retention above entrances, walkways, and lower roofs. A standing-seam roof that sheds a 3-foot slab of ice onto the driveway is a liability. Budget $8 to $15 per linear foot for a properly engineered snow-retention system attached to the standing-seam ribs [3].
alaska business registration and insurance: the paper trail before you climb
The state does not test you on roofing. But the paper comes first. Here is the order of operations to get legal to sign a contract in Alaska:
1. Form your business entity (LLC, corporation, or sole proprietorship) with the Alaska Division of Corporations, Business and Professional Licensing. Filing the Articles of Organization online costs $250 as of 2025 [1]. 2. Register your business name and get an Alaska business license from the same division ($50 per year). This license says you exist. It does not mean you know how to seam metal. 3. Check the municipality or borough where you'll work. Anchorage requires a separate city business license and a contractor license with a $10,000 bond; the application runs through the Development Services Department [5]. The Fairbanks North Star Borough requires a business license for contractors working within the borough; it's revenue-based and renewed annually [14]. 4. Get insurance. General liability at $1,000,000 per occurrence and aggregate is the standard minimum. Add workers' compensation through the state-run system or a private carrier. The Alaska Workers' Compensation Act mandates coverage for all employees from day one. Sole proprietors with no employees may file for an exemption, but that exemption evaporates the moment you hire help [6]. 5. Set up your Alaska Department of Revenue tax account if you have employees or if the borough collects sales tax. You need a state withholding tax ID even for a one-person crew if you pay yourself payroll.
After those five steps, you can legally bid. The permit process is separate and driven by the local building department where the roof sits.
what does shipping do to a standing-seam roof budget in alaska?
Shipping adds 8 to 22% to the material cost for a standing-seam renewal in Alaska compared to the same job in Seattle or Portland. The percentage sounds small, but it hits hard in cash because the base material number already runs $6 to $10 per square foot.
For a road-system job (Anchorage, Mat-Su, Fairbanks, Kenai), most metal roofing rides a barge from Seattle to the Port of Alaska. The barge line charges $0.08 to $0.15 per pound for breakbulk freight, depending on the commodity code. A 2,000 sq ft panel order weighing roughly 1,700 to 2,000 pounds costs $200 to $350 in barge freight plus $150 to $300 to truck it from terminal to job site. That's manageable.
Off-road-system jobs are the budget killer. A standing-seam order for a house in Bethel or Nome goes by air or seasonal barge. The Alaska Marine Highway System and private carriers like Lynden or AML run scheduled service to hub communities, but smaller villages may get one spring barge a year. Miss the May barge and you wait until June. Air freight to a hub like Kotzebue can run $1.50 to $3.00 per pound for cargo, turning a 2,000-pound panel shipment into a $4,000 line item [15].
Some Alaska contractors stock panel coils and roll-form on site with a portable roll-former. That cuts freight weight by 60% (coils instead of formed panels) and removes the risk of long panels crushed in transit. A portable roll-former rental runs $1,500 to $3,000 per week, but the savings on barge freight and the ability to make custom lengths exactly when you need them pays off on remote jobs. If you order panels from a Lower 48 supplier, confirm they pack for marine transit: crated, wrapped, and with desiccant packs. Standing-seam panels that arrive with salt-spray rust have killed Alaska jobs before they start.
permits and inspections for a standing-seam roof renewal in alaska
Reroofing requires a building permit in nearly every Alaska city and borough with a code enforcement department. Unincorporated areas and some very small communities may not require permits, but that gap is shrinking as the state pushes IRC adoption.
A residential reroof permit application in Anchorage requires:
- A completed building permit application.
- Two sets of plans or drawings showing the roof layout, panel type, underlayment, and fastening pattern.
- A structural engineer's stamped calcs for snow load if the job adds dead load (a roof-over) or if the existing trusses need reinforcement.
- The permit fee, which ranges $150 to $500 depending on the valuation of the work. Anchorage's fee schedule sets reroof valuation at $6.00 per square foot minimum, and the permit fee runs $0.80 per $1,000 of valuation plus a $45 base fee [9].
How long it takes: Anchorage's residential plan review is averaging 18 business days as of mid-2025 [10]. Fairbanks and Juneau run similar timeframes, 15 to 20 business days, barring missing information. At final, the inspector looks for two things: fastening per the approved plans and edge details that resist wind uplift. Alaska's coastal wind zones demand specific edge-metal details per IRC section R905 [12].
Some rural properties outside organized boroughs have no building department. The State Fire Marshal's office acts as the default code authority for plan review in those areas under 13 AAC 50. If you're working truly off-grid, confirm with the State Fire Marshal whether a permit is required for a re-roof [16]. Skip a permit and you may find out at sale that the bank won't finance the house without a certificate of occupancy tied to the permitted roof.
what makes a standing-seam roof work in alaska's climate?
Cold, snow, wind, ice, and freeze-thaw cycles run a durability gauntlet that separates good standing-seam installs from failures inside three winters. A metal roof installed right in Alaska should last 40 to 60 years. Installed wrong, it leaks in two seasons.
Five design choices that matter here:
1. Full-coverage ice and water shield. The IRC requires ice barrier membrane in cold climates from the eaves to a point 24 inches inside the exterior wall line. In Alaska, many engineers and roof consultants spec full-coverage peel-and-stick membrane over the entire deck, more than the eaves. It adds $1.50 to $2.00 per square foot and stops the ice-dam leaks that form when snow melts at the ridge and refreezes at the cold eave [13].
2. Mechanical seams over snap-lock. Snap-lock panels are common on Lower 48 houses but rely on friction and shallow engagement. In high-wind coastal Alaska or on roofs above 4:12 with heavy snow sliding, mechanically seamed panels (double-locked with a seamer) resist uplift better. The tradeoff is cost: mechanical-seam panels add roughly $2.00 to $3.00 per square foot in labor and tooling.
3. Under-ridge ventilation. A cold roof assembly with an air gap and ridge vent prevents ice dams and keeps the metal from sweating on the underside. The IRC minimum net free vent area is 1/150 of the attic area, split between soffit and ridge. Alaska's cold makes the ratio matter: a roof that doesn't vent in Fairbanks can drop condensation onto the insulation all winter.
4. Snow-retention systems. Covered above, but worth repeating. A standing-seam roof is slippery. Snow guards, pipe-style fences, or clamp-on brackets are code-required above doorways and walkways in many boroughs.
5. Fastener compatibility. Pressure-treated lumber in Alaska roof decks (often for rot resistance in coastal areas) requires stainless steel fasteners, not standard electroplated screws. The reaction between copper-based treatments and mild steel voids panel warranties and creates a rust pattern in one season [3].
will a standing-seam roof save money on heating and insurance in alaska?
Maybe on insurance. Probably not a dramatic amount on heating. The insurance break is real and comes from the roof's Class A fire rating and impact resistance. A standing-seam metal roof earns a Class A fire rating (the highest) under ASTM E108, which many Alaska homeowners' insurers credit with a 5 to 15% premium reduction. The credit varies by carrier and by wildfire zone. In the Mat-Su and Kenai, where spruce-bark beetle kill and dry summers push wildfire risk up, a metal roof can mean the difference between a policy renewal and a non-renewal letter [3]. Call your agent before the roof goes on; they need to note the upgrade on the policy.
On heating, the story is less crisp. A standing-seam roof adds no measurable insulation value by itself. The metal sits outside the thermal envelope. What changes the heating bill is the work you do under the roof while it's open: rigid foam above the deck (a nailbase panel) or air-sealing the attic floor. An unvented cathedral ceiling with 4 inches of polyisocyanurate foam board and a standing-seam roof on top can cut heat loss through the roof by 25 to 40% compared to a vented attic with R-38 fiberglass and air leaks. But that's an insulation upgrade, not a roof-material upgrade. If you're paying to open the roof anyway, it's the right time to add insulation [4].
The rebate conversation is short. Alaska has minimal state-level energy-efficiency rebates. The Alaska Housing Finance Corporation runs a weatherization program aimed at low-income households, and the federal residential clean energy tax credit (25C) covers insulation and air sealing at 30% up to $1,200 annually. It does not cover roofing materials unless they're also solar-reflective. Not many standing-seam panels in Alaska get installed for reflectivity. They get installed for snow and ice.
is diy standing-seam roof renewal realistic in alaska?
It's legal. It's also one of the harder DIY moves a homeowner can make in this state. Alaska code lets a homeowner act as their own general contractor and pull a building permit for their primary residence without a contractor license [1]. Still, a standing-seam roof is a heavy, long, sharp-edged system that needs a team to handle panels safely in wind.
What a homeowner can do: demolition of the existing roof, underlayment placement, and trim work. What a homeowner rarely does well without experience: seaming long panels straight in 15-mph wind, setting 30-foot panels on an 8:12 pitch without a crane or panel lift, and engineering a snow-retention layout that won't blow out in a 100-year storm.
If you're a skilled builder with a crew of friends, a trailer, and a panel lift, you can knock $7.00 to $10.00 per square foot off the installed cost. Factor in the tooling. A manual seamer for mechanical-seam panels starts at $400. A panel-lift rental for a week runs $350 to $600 in Anchorage. Personal fall-arrest gear good enough for a 20-foot ridge is $300 per person. The biggest risk on a DIY Alaska renewal is the engineering gap. If the snow-load letter says clip spacing at 18 inches and you install at 24, the building department makes you rip it off. One failed inspection and you're into a second set of panels.
how to choose a standing-seam roofing contractor in alaska
The state won't vet them for you. No license board, no roofing-specific complaint lookup. You vet them with references, insurance certificates, and permit history.
What to ask any Alaska contractor you're considering:
- "Show me your current Alaska DCCED business license and your municipal business license for this borough." A screenshot of the online filing works. It exists or it doesn't.
- "Give me your insurance agent's name and number and the policy number for general liability and workers' comp." Call the agent. Confirm the policy is active and paid.
- "Show me three standing-seam renewals you finished in Alaska in the last two years, with addresses I can drive by." If all their photos are from Seattle, that's a flag.
- "Who is your structural engineer for this job? Can I see the snow-load calcs they prepared for a similar project?" The engineer relationship matters. A contractor with a go-to engineer in Anchorage or Juneau can turn a permit package in a week. One without that relationship will stall.
- "What's your plan for material shipping and storage?" If the panels sit on a barge for three weeks or in a Conex in the rain at the job site, they need to be packed for it.
Contractors in Alaska aren't legally required to provide a written contract above a certain dollar threshold, but you want one anyway. The contract should spell out panel gauge and brand, the engineering scope, permit responsibility, and the weather-delay clause. In Alaska, a clear weather-delay clause isn't the contractor weaseling out. It's a partner admitting that October in Valdez runs the schedule.
Frequently asked questions
Do I need a roofing license in Anchorage for standing-seam work?
You need an Anchorage municipal contractor license, which requires a business license, a $10,000 bond, and proof of insurance. The city does not test roofing competence. The application goes through the Development Services Department and the fee is separate from the business license [5].
How much does a standing-seam roof cost per square foot in Anchorage?
Installed costs in Anchorage run $20 to $30 per square foot as of 2025. The lower end is a simple gable with snap-lock panels and no tear-off. The higher end includes tear-off, mechanical-seam panels, a full ice-and-water membrane, and an engineer's snow-load package.
Can I install standing-seam roof panels myself in Alaska?
Yes. Homeowners can pull their own permit and do the work on their primary residence without a contractor license. The risk is snow-load engineering and panel handling. A failed inspection for incorrect clip spacing or missing snow-retention can cost more than the labor savings.
What ground snow load should my roof design accommodate in Juneau?
The SEAA snow load map assigns 55 psf ground snow load at sea level in Juneau and 80 psf or more at higher elevations [7]. Always confirm with a local structural engineer. Site-specific exposure, roof pitch, and thermal factors adjust the final design number.
How long does it take to get a roofing permit in Fairbanks?
The Fairbanks North Star Borough building department averages 15 to 20 business days for residential re-roof permit review as of 2025. Incomplete engineering calcs for snow load or missing underlayment specs will extend that by two weeks or more [9].
What is the best underlayment for a standing-seam roof in Southeast Alaska?
A full-coverage peel-and-stick ice-and-water shield, typically 40 to 60 mils thick, is the standard recommendation in Southeast Alaska's high-rain climate. Many installers add a ventilated air gap above the old roof on a roof-over to prevent trapped moisture [13].
Does a standing-seam roof lower insurance in Alaska?
It can. Many Alaska insurers offer a 5 to 15% discount for a Class A fire-rated roof. In wildfire-risk areas like the Kenai or Mat-Su, a metal roof can help avoid policy non-renewal. Discounts vary by carrier, so call your agent before you start the job [3].
Do I need a special license for federal or military base roofing in Alaska?
The state has no special license, but federal prevailing-wage contracts often require a vendor to show no record of debarment, specific insurance endorsements, and sometimes a bonding line. Check the solicitation packet from the base contracting office.
What is the typical warranty on a standing-seam panel in Alaska?
Panel manufacturers typically offer a 25 to 40 year paint warranty and a 50-year structural warranty on 24-gauge Kynar-coated steel. Warranties often exclude coastal salt spray within 1,500 feet of saltwater unless you specify marine-grade substrate. Read the fine print.
Can I roof-over an existing shingle roof with standing-seam in Fairbanks?
Often yes. Fairbanks' dry climate simplifies the moisture question, but you still need an engineer's letter confirming the trusses can handle the added dead load plus the design snow load. Most buildings in Fairbanks were designed for 60 psf ground snow [7].
How much does shipping add to a standing-seam roof order in Alaska?
Shipping adds 8 to 22% to the material line. Road-system jobs in Anchorage or Mat-Su see $300 to $600 total freight. Off-road jobs can see $4,000 or more for air freight or seasonal barges. Some contractors run portable roll-formers to avoid shipping formed panels [15].
Do I need snow guards on a standing-seam roof in Alaska?
Most borough codes and plain common sense say yes above doorways, walkways, and driveways. Snow sliding off a metal roof is fast, heavy, and dangerous. Budget $8 to $15 per linear foot for engineered snow-retention that fastens to the panel ribs without breaching the roof [3].
